A position of Engineering Method and Tools for MBSE (m/f) has just opened within Airbus Helicopters in Marignane.
You will join the department Engineering Enablers – ETE in Engineering whose mission is to set up foundation to allow Engineering to reach the highest efficiency, to provide most added value to our customers by deploying, guiding, improving our portfolios of Tools, Solutions and Ways of Working.
As part of the Digital Methods & Tools team, integrated into the DDMS (Digital for Design Manufacturing & Services) SQUAD, you will be involved in a team in charge of :
Developing Methods and Tools capabilities to put in place the integration of MBSE, Model Based System for architecture/missions loops optimization as well as End to End product development.
Reinforcing the link between physical simulation (Computer Aided Engineering & Multiphysics product simulation) and system architecture design.
Securing the digital continuity from Requirements, to System Modeling (MOFTL framework) with software & avionics management (ALM) until Electrical design integration (Pin2Pin)

Tasks and responsibilities:
In synergy with other team members of Method and Tools department, you will have to leverage these skills on a large variety of interesting challenges:
contribute to the definition of the strategical M&T Roadmaps for MBSE integration in vehicule/avionics implementation optimization studies for new H/C or drone program or transverse programs.
contribute to set up users coaching (material and operations) to methodologies with MBSE as input for predictive simulations and Weight&Balance
contribute to drive tool(s) support activities for the different layers of MBSE landscape including integration with simulation.
be the focal point of Airbus Helicopters Engineers to ensure seamless digital integration of process and methods for MBSE models validation, change, reuse and systems of systems concept.
be part of Group projects/initiatives such as DDMS (digital continuity transformation project) especially for MBSE as input for parametric predictive simulations
This position will lead you to work and interact with experts from different engineering métiers (architects, Weight & Balance, safety, mission systems, simulation …) from AH or Airbus Group.
Skills & Prerequisites:
The skills expected or to be reinforced in the ramp-up period are:
Advanced knowledge in MBSE approach (including parametric approach challenge, ontology based approach…) for vehicle architecture or mission equipment trade-offs studies.
Experience in a MBSE tool usage as Enterprise Architecture, Capella, MagicDraw, CATIAMagic, IBM Rhapsody…and/or in a simulation tool as MATLAB/Simulink
Systems Engineering framework (civil or military) and SysML language knowledge for good understanding/handling of metamodels for multiprograms applicability purpose.
Experience in Computer Aided Engineering (CAE) or in collaborative projects (SE/MBSE and simulation)

Airbus is a global leader in aeronautics, space and related services. In 2020, it generated revenues of €49.9 billion and employed a workforce of around 130,000. Airbus offers the most comprehensive range of passenger airliners. Airbus is also a European leader providing tanker, combat, transport and mission aircraft, as well as one of the world’s leading space companies. In helicopters, Airbus provides the most efficient civil and military rotorcraft solutions worldwide.
